Condominium law basics in Massachusetts

A condominium arrangement is a unique form of property ownership where a resident owns a unit and shares ownership of common areas, such as hallways, stairwells, walkways, driveways, yards and curtilage. Owners of individual condo units have the right to sell their property at any time.

Condominium arrangements can be made for a large variety of residential structures:

  • Detached single and duplex residences
  • Townhouses
  • Low-rise buildings
  • High-rise buildings

Merchants can also enter condominium arrangements for commercial properties.

In Boston, condominiums are governed by Massachusetts General Law Chapter 183A, which requires that various documents be filed, including a master deed for the entire property and unit deeds for each individual unit.
